Calories in 4 oz (112 g) Jumbo Raw Shrimp?

4 oz (112 g) Jumbo Raw Shrimp is 70 calories.

Looking for a low-calorie seafood option? Look no further than 4 oz (112 g) of jumbo raw shrimp, which contain only 70 calories. But that's not all - this dish is also packed with nutrients that are essential to maintaining a healthy diet.

Jumbo raw shrimp are high in protein, making them an excellent choice for those looking to build muscle or maintain their current muscle mass. With about 17 grams of protein per serving, these shrimp offer a healthy amount of this essential macronutrient. They are also a rich source of selenium, an important nutrient that supports your metabolism and helps your body produce antioxidants.

5 FAQs About Jumbo Raw Shrimp

1. How many jumbo raw shrimp are in a serving?

A serving size of jumbo raw shrimp is typically 4 oz (112 g), which is roughly equivalent to 4-6 shrimp, depending on their size.

2. How many calories are in a serving of jumbo raw shrimp?

A serving of jumbo raw shrimp contains approximately 70 calories, making it a low-calorie and high-protein option for those watching their weight.

3. Is it safe to eat jumbo raw shrimp?

Jumbo raw shrimp is generally safe to eat, but it should be properly cleaned and cooked to avoid any potential foodborne illnesses. Always purchase shrimp from a reputable source and follow safe food handling guidelines.

4. What are some popular ways to cook jumbo raw shrimp?

Jumbo raw shrimp can be cooked in a variety of ways, including grilling, sautéing, broiling, and baking. Some popular recipes include shrimp scampi, shrimp cocktail, and shrimp stir-fry.

5. Are jumbo raw shrimp a healthy food choice?

Yes, jumbo raw shrimp is a healthy food choice as it is low in calories and high in protein. It is also a good source of vitamins and minerals, including vitamin B12, iron, and selenium.

Nutritional Values of 4 oz (112 g) Jumbo Raw Shrimp

UnitValue
Calories (kcal)70 kcal
Fat (g)0 g
Carbs (g)0 g
Protein (g)16 g

Calorie breakdown: 0% fat, 0% carbs, 100% protein
